Algebra II (Intermediate Algebra) is an educational show designed to help students master algebraic concepts and skills. The show's fifth episode, titled "Algebra II: Quadratic Equations - Factoring (Level 2 of 10) | Binomials I," focuses on teaching students how to factor quadratic equations using binomials.
The episode begins with an introduction to quadratic equations and their importance in mathematics, science, and engineering. The host, a knowledgeable and experienced math teacher, explains that quadratic equations are second-degree polynomials with a variable raised to the power of two. He then talks about how factoring quadratic equations into binomials can help solve mathematical problems more efficiently and effectively than other methods.
The first part of the episode covers the basics of factoring quadratic equations with simple coefficients. The host explains how to identify the terms of a quadratic equation and how to factor them using the box method. He goes on to demonstrate how to find the factors of a quadratic equation using the product-sum method, which involves finding two numbers that multiply to the equation's constant term and add up to its coefficient of the variable term.
In the next segment, the host moves on to more complex quadratic equations that require factoring binomials. He explains how to identify the terms of a binomial and how to factor binomials into their constituent parts. The host also introduces the difference of squares formula, which is a special case of binomial factoring that helps simplify quadratic equations with perfect squares.
The episode then moves on to solving quadratic equations using factoring and the zero product property. The host explains that any factored quadratic equation will have two solutions – one for each factor – and that these solutions can be found by setting each factor equal to zero and solving for the variable. The host illustrates this concept using several examples of quadratic equations with different coefficients and variables.
Next, the episode covers the topic of graphing quadratic equations. The host explains that quadratic equations can be graphed on a coordinate plane using the vertex form – a simplified form of a quadratic equation that makes it easier to find the vertex, maximum or minimum value, and axis of symmetry. The host then shows how to use the vertex form to graph quadratic equations with different coefficients and variables.
The final segment of the episode covers challenging examples of binomial factoring and quadratic equation solving. The host presents several examples of quadratic equations with more complex coefficients and variables, showing how to identify the correct binomial factors and how to solve for the variable using factoring and the zero product property. He also illustrates how to graph these equations using the vertex form.
